hendiadys

One entry found.


Main Entry:
hen·di·a·dys 
          Listen to the pronunciation of hendiadys
Pronunciation:
\hen-ˈdī-ə-dəs\
Function:
noun
Etymology:
Late Latin hendiadys, hendiadyoin, modification of Greek hen dia dyoin, literally, one through two
Date:
circa 1577
: the expression of an idea by the use of usually two independent words connected by and (as nice and warm) instead of the usual combination of independent word and its modifier (as nicely warm)
